  • Experiment
    Seven somatic cell hybrids were from fusions of Chinese hamster and mouse cells. These hybrids were probed for mouse genes Col6a1, Col6a2 and Itgb2 using cDNA probes for human genes COL6A1, COL6A2, ITGB2 and for mouse gene S100b using a cDNA probe for rat BPB. All loci exhibited concordant segregation with Chromosome 10 from the hybrid sets. Data not provided.
